What is an Accident Compensation Attorney?

An accident compensation attorney is a legal professional who specializes in representing people who have actually been injured due to the negligence or wrongful actions of another celebration. Their main role is to assist victims safe compensation for their injuries, suffering, and losses.

Key Responsibilities of Accident Compensation Attorneys

Responsibilities Information
Case Evaluation Evaluating the specifics of the case and figuring out the capacity for compensation.
Legal Advice Offering information about rights and legal alternatives offered to the victim.
Collecting Evidence Gathering all required documents, proof, and witness statements to develop a strong case.
Settlement Managing negotiations with insurance provider to make sure fair compensation.
Lawsuits Representing the customer in court if a fair settlement can not be reached through settlement.
Post-Settlement Counsel Recommending on managing granted compensation and dealing with any tax ramifications.

Kinds Of Accidents Covered

Accident compensation lawyers generally handle a range of cases, including however not limited to:

  • Vehicle Accidents: Car, motorcycle, and truck accidents brought on by negligent driving.
  • Work environment Injuries: Accidents that occur in the work environment, often covered under employees' compensation laws.
  • Slip and Fall Incidents: Injuries happening due to unsafe conditions in public or personal premises.
  • Medical Malpractice: Cases where a doctor stops working to stick to the accepted standards of care, leading to injury.
  • Item Liability: Injuries caused by malfunctioning or hazardous products.
  • Industrial Accidents: Injuries connected with equipment or hazardous work environment conditions.

FAQ about Accident Compensation Attorneys

1. What should I do right away after an accident?

  • Look for medical attention for injuries.
  • File the scene: Take photos, gather witness information, and file a police report if appropriate.
  • Contact an accident compensation attorney for a totally free assessment.

2. How long do I need to file a claim?

  • The statute of restrictions differs by state, but normally, you have 1-3 years from the date of the accident to submit a claim.

3. Will I need to go to court?

  • Many cases are settled out of court. However, if a fair settlement can not be reached, your attorney may advise litigation.

4. What damages can I claim?

  • You may claim medical expenses, lost earnings, discomfort and suffering, psychological distress, and other appropriate losses connected to the accident.

5. Just how much will it cost to work with an attorney?

  • The majority of accident compensation lawyers work on a contingency fee basis, meaning you will pay them a percentage of the settlement just if you win.
